Leprosy - Number of new leprosy cases among children in Somalia
Somalia: Leprosy - Number of new leprosy cases among children was 34 in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Leprosy - Number of new leprosy cases among children in Somalia, 2012–2024
Source: World Health Organization, Global Health Observatory.
Analysis
Somalia recorded 34 for leprosy - number of new leprosy cases among children in 2024.
The figure is down 27.7% on the previous year and up 1,600.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, leprosy - number of new leprosy cases among children in Somalia peaked at 188 in 2017 and was at its lowest, 2, in 2014.
Somalia ranks 22nd of 169 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Leprosy - Number of new leprosy cases among children in Somalia,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 21 | — |
| 2014 | 2 | -90.5% |
| 2015 | 9 | +350.0% |
| 2016 | 44 | +388.9% |
| 2017 | 188 | +327.3% |
| 2018 | 138 | -26.6% |
| 2019 | 35 | -74.6% |
| 2020 | 108 | +208.6% |
| 2021 | 106 | -1.9% |
| 2022 | 33 | -68.9% |
| 2023 | 47 | +42.4% |
| 2024 | 34 | -27.7% |
